Ornette Coleman - Something Else Product No: ACONC 595
Available: LimitedStock
Category: 180 Gram Vinyl Record
Label: Contemporary Records (Acoustic Sounds Series)

Not my favorite mixing, but the pressing is great

4 Stars
Posted Wednesday, December 24, 2025 by Andrew I like the recording, but did not expect the panning to be so radical: it sounds like as if my speakers are turned not to me, but L to the left and R to the right, making a huge gap in the middle... I can't blame the recording though, especially that Coleman's alto and Cherry's trumpet are in the same channel, probably it was done historically and you can't separate them. However, the sound realism is great: the bass is deep and clear, cymbals are distinct yet not agressive, and trumpet's surdine is full of harmonics (or overtones)...

Miles Davis - Agharta Product No: AMOB 567
Available: InStock
Category: 180 Gram Vinyl Record
Label: Mobile Fidelity

An epic record for a epic live show

5 Stars
Posted Wednesday, November 12, 2025 by Johnny T Wow, I didn't expect this record to be so spectacular. I listen to the "CD quality" stream quite a lot, and that now seems muddied and compressed compared to this. Instrument separation here is fantastic. It really does sound like I'm amongst the musicians playing their instruments rather than just listening to a track. This record really puts the digital stream version in its place, as this is superior in every way. The streaming version almost sounds like FM Radio by comparison.

What floored me is the level of detail. I am constantly hearing things I had not heard before at all. For example in Prelude Part 2, I am keenly aware of Reggie Lucas's jamming during Pete Cosey's solo. There are parts where I didn't even know he was playing before. All of the little side notes are elevated so that nothing is missed. This record does justice to this special part of Miles Davis's career.
